Governor Ahmadu Umaru Fintiri has officially announced the unification of his political forces into a new, cohesive All Progressives Congress (APC) in Adamawa State. This significant step aims to enhance the party’s strength and effectiveness in the region.
In his statement, Gov. Fintiri expressed confidence in the newly established structures, stating, “With our structures now fully in place from Ward to State levels, we are stronger, more focused, and ready.
Our mission is clear: absolute victory for the Renewed Hope agenda.” This reflects a commitment to mobilizing resources and support for the party’s objectives.
The governor also extended his congratulations to Alhaji Hamza Bello, the newly elected State Chairman, along with all other elected executives. Their leadership will be vital in driving the party’s agenda and fostering unity within the ranks as they prepare for future electoral challenges.
